个人简介

毛国斌,中国科学院深圳先进技术研究材料所副研究员,硕士生导师,深圳市高层次人才。2014年于华中农业大学获应用化学学士学位,2019年于武汉大学获得分析化学博士学位,2019年-2021年在中国科学院深圳先进技术研究院开展博士后研究。近年来主要从事荧光纳米传感与合成生物学传感等相关研究,致力于开发基于量子点等纳米探针与CRISPR/Cas系统等合成生物学系统的超高灵敏生物传感器,实现病毒感染检测、肿瘤早期诊断及慢性疾病监测。以第一(共同第一)/共同通讯作者在J. Am. Chem. Soc., Sci. China-Life Sci., ACS Sens., ACS Appl. Mater. Interfaces, Nano Res., Anal. Chem.等期刊发表论文27篇。在相关领域申请了发明专利13项,授权6项。主持国家自然科学基金青年项目、中国博士后基金面上项目、广东省基础与应用基础区域联合基金等项目4项。作为核心骨干参与科技部国家重点研发计划项目1项。

研究领域

合成生物学传感;纳米生物学传感
